# Break-Glass: Catalog Cache Invalidation

Scope: the Pinrow product catalog at Veldstone Retail. If stale prices persist after a purge and the Hollowmere invalidation queue is wedged, use break-glass to flush the edge tier directly. Contractors: get verbal sign-off from the catalog lead first. Steps: open the Hollowmere admin shell, select emergency-flush, confirm the tenant, and run it once — repeated flushes thrash the origin. Access is logged and expires after 20 minutes. Unseal the admin shell with the passphrase below.

recovery phrase for kahop-tajog: istix-casvan

Quarterly Planning Note — Brindlecote Pilot. For the incoming director: churn in the Brindlecote pilot programme rose to 13% this quarter, concentrated among smaller accounts onboarded during the summer push. Root-cause analysis indicates mismatched expectations set during trial sign-up rather than product defects. We have tightened qualification criteria and extended the trial period to sixty days. Retention metrics will be tracked weekly from January. The confidential planning context is set out directly below.

confidential, kagup-bafog: Fraaxax Group is in early talks to buy Soroxox Group for about $343.8 million. The Olidor launch date is June 14, and nothing goes to the press before then. Legal wants the Aldmirek Logistics term sheet signed before July 23.

Hey, flagging this for your review pass: the cert bundle on the Furrowlink farm-equipment telemetry gateway expired Tuesday, so tractors in the Hollowmere region stopped reporting soil and fuel data. Nobody noticed because the dashboard cached stale readings — separate bug, separate ticket.

We've reissued the gateway credentials and shortened the rotation window to 60 days. Before we close this out, please verify the new credential meets policy. For reference, here's the freshly issued key for the gateway's ingest service.

API key for fadug-fafof: kto7_7rjklQM

PointsPerch is the loyalty-points ledger behind the Ferncask rewards program. Support staff run a local read-only instance to trace balance disputes. Setup: clone the repo, run the bootstrap script, copy .env.example to .env. The ledger API refuses connections until the access credential is configured, so add the following line to .env:

env line for fafof-fahag: LEDGER_TOKEN5=f8790